    Three teams have dominated the top of the Spanish top-flight in recent years. The big two of Barcelona and Real Madrid have seemingly been battling for supremacy in La Liga since the dawn of time.

    Real Madrid’s arch-rivals Atletico have muscled in on the cosy duopoly in recent years. Los Rojiblancos may have only won one Spanish title in the last two decades, but they have consistently punched above their weight in La Liga.

    On Sunday night, Atletico will likely prove a tough obstacle for league leaders and champions Barcelona to overcome at the Wanda Metropolitano.

    Atletico’s form has not been great of late, though, as Diego Simeone’s team have won just once in six competitive matches. Their recent La Liga campaign has been dogged by draws, with three of their last four outings ending all-square.

    Despite a plethora of draws in the Spanish top-flight in recent months, Atletico are still fourth in the table, just three points behind the visitors from Catalonia.

    Simeone has created a team that is hard to defeat, tough and resilient in his image as a player. Those qualities have led to Atletico’s 14-match unbeaten run in La Liga on home soil.

    Barcelona are top of the table, but arch-rivals Real Madrid are level on points with the champions. Ernesto Valverde’s side has now recorded four consecutive competitive wins after a midweek 3-1 Champions League win over Dortmund.

    The Catalan giants have not just reserved their good results for Europe’s elite competition, though, as they have also won seven of their last eight games in the Spanish top-flight.

    The visitors have certainly lived up to their reputation as one of the best attacking teams in the European game of late, as they have fired home at least two goals in seven of their last eight league outings.

    Forebet predicts that Barcelona will once again fire in Madrid, but that wily Atletico will hold them to a high-scoring draw.
